Château d’Ainay-le-Vieil is a medieval château in Ainay-le-Vieil, Centre-Val de Loire, France, noted for its preserved fortifications. The site retains characteristic defensive elements such as a moat, towers and a compact keep.
The present appearance reflects successive medieval and early modern building phases and the château is recognised for the survival of its defensive plan and domestic buildings. It occupies a riverside or lowland setting within the Cher department and is a local landmark of medieval military and residential architecture.

How to Get to Château d'Ainay-le-Vieil #
Ainay-le-Vieil lies in Cher, a short drive from the A71 / D955. By rail, the nearest major station is Bourges (about 40 km); from there rent a car or take local buses. The château is signposted from nearby departmental roads.
